Merge branch 'dsa-netconsole'
Florian Fainelli says: ==================== net: GENET, SYSTEMPORT and DSA netconsole This patch series adds support for netconsole in the GENET, SYSTEMPORT and DSA drivers. A small refactoring to the DSA transmit path is required to avoid duplicating the dsa_netpoll_send_skb() into each and every tagging protocol supported. Testing on e.g: mv643xx_eth and/or e1000e would be much appreciated! Changes in v2: - properly disable/enable interrupts in GENET and SYSTEMPORT - pass the reallocated SKB back to dsa_slave_xmit() in case a tag protocol had to alter the original SKB ==================== Signed-off-by: David S.
